The Diablo IV team is looking for a Technical Designer with a passion for improving pipelines and workflows, a commitment to learning, a collaborative attitude, and the desire to inquire “how can we make it better?”
As a Technical Designer, you provide technical and creative support to the Diablo IV team by helping facilitate the efficient creation of clean and performant content. As an advocate for developer workflows, you collaborate with multiple disciplines to come up with the best solution for difficult problems and champion the process throughout.
Responsibilities
Cultivate and maintain collaborative relationships across all disciplines
Champion workflow improvements
Analyze existing workflows and tools to determine necessary improvements
Work with engineering to request and refine workflow and tool changes
Serve as a technical point of contact for content reviews, standards, and best practices
Diagnose, debug, and fix content issues
Create content and help design gameplay systems
Minimum Requirements
Experience
3+ years as a Technical Designer
Contributed to content in multiple design areas (levels, systems, encounters, UI, etc.)
Experience in pipeline development and process improvement
Experience in scripting or programming game content
Knowledge & Skills
Deep understanding of design workflows in multiple game editors
Ability to create design documents for tools and game systems
Key Attributes
Excellent written and verbal communication skills
A passion for cross discipline collaboration
